Canelo Alvarez names British opponent as easiest fight of career

Canelo Alvarez insists his easiest night as a professional came against Rocky Fielding.

The Mexican superstar admitted as much during a quick-fire social media interview with boxing broadcaster Dan Canobbio.

    Asked who his easiest fight was, Canelo paused for a moment before picking ‘Rocky From Stocky’.

    Canelo squared off against Fielding at New York’s Madison Square Garden in December 2018. 

    Fielding entered the contest as the WBA ‘regular’ super middleweight champion but had the lesser world title snatched from him in emphatic fashion. 

    The Liverpudlian got dropped in each of the first two rounds with body shots before a thudding right to the chin sent him tumbling to the canvas for a third time in round three.

    When Fielding made his way back to his feet, the referee, Ricky Gonzalez, warned him that one more knockdown would signal the end of the fight. 

    And true to his word, Gonzalez stepped in and waved off the contest after Fielding was dropped by another sweeping left to the body moments later. 

    According to the CompuBox punch stats, Fielding landed just 37 of 183 blows (30%), while Canelo found a home for 73 of 141 (52%).

    In the immediate aftermath, Fielding was incredibly critical of his performance.

    But in reality, Canelo was simply too good for the brave Liverpudlian.

    “He’s an elite fighter, you know,” said Fielding “I went in there trying my best, and that’s what elite fighters are like.

    “The body shots were more like the wind was getting took, so he placed the shots well.

    “I stood there too long. I thought I could try to mix it with him when I shouldn’t have.

    “Again, as I said, you see the height of me compared to him, I should have kept it long, but I just stood there with someone who’s elite and who’s stronger, and he caught me.

    “I gave it everything, and the better man won.

    “I dared to be great, I lived a dream. I’ll come again, I’ll come back.

    “Hats off to Canelo. He’s a great fighter, I respect him. I’ll come back.”

    Fielding boxed four more times after losing to Canelo.

    A trio of stoppage wins over unheralded opposition led to a British and Commonwealth light-heavyweight title fight against Dan Azeez.

    He was subsequently stopped in the eighth round, thus signalling the end of a 33-fight (30-3) career that included a win over John Ryder and losses to Callum Smith and Canelo.
